【解决方案1】:

崩溃报告告诉 JIT 编译器线程中发生了错误:

Current thread (0x00007f89e481c800):  JavaThread "C2 CompilerThread1"

采取以下步骤诊断编译器问题:

  1. 试用 JDK 9 EA 中可用的最新 JVM 构建:https://jdk9.java.net/download/

    如果问题消失,您可以继续使用此版本,或者尝试找到解决问题的确切提交,然后将其反向移植到 JDK 8。如何反向移植修复以及如何自己构建 HotSpot - 这是一个单独的主题,但我可以告诉你是否有兴趣。

  2. 如果问题仍然存在,请尝试找到有问题的方法并将其从编译中排除。

    Current CompileTask: C2: 114667 5303 4 com.sosse.time.timeseries.gson.TypeConverterHelper::deserialize (157 bytes)
    

    在您的情况下,它似乎无法编译 TypeConverterHelper.deserialize()。添加以下 JVM 选项以排除此特定方法:

    -XX:CompileCommand=exclude,com.sosse.time.timeseries.gson.TypeConverterHelper::deserialize
    
  3. 如果没有帮助,请尝试通过提供多个-XX:CompileCommand 来排除更多方法。要查找要排除的候选人,请使用-XX:+PrintCompilation 并查看打印列表的底部。您还可以从编译中排除整个类和包,例如

    -XX:CompileCommand=exclude,com.sosse.time.timeseries.gson.*::*
    
  4. 尝试一一禁用某些编译器优化。可以尝试的一些选项是:

    -XX:-DoEscapeAnalysis
    -XX:LoopUnrollLimit=0
    -XX:-PartialPeelLoop
    -XX:-UseLoopPredicate
    -XX:-LoopUnswitching
    -XX:-ReassociateInvariants
    -XX:MaxInlineLevel=1
    -XX:-IncrementalInline
    -XX:-RangeCheckElimination
    -XX:-EliminateAllocations
    -XX:-UseTypeProfile
    -XX:AliasLevel=0
    
  5. 无论是否找到有问题的方法/优化,再次运行 JVM

    -XX:+UnlockDiagnosticVMOptions -XX:+LogCompilation
    

    这将在当前目录中创建hotspot_pid1234.log 文件,其中包含详细的编译日志。

  6. bugreport.java.com 提交错误报告。选择

    Product/Category: HotSpot Virtual Machine (errors)
    Subcategory:      J2SE Server Compiler
    

    确保包含第 5 步中的完整 hs_err_pid.loghotspot_pid.log。如果您可以提供一个简化的独立示例来演示该问题,这将非常有帮助。

    为了更快的反应,您也可以向hotspot-compiler-dev 邮件列表发消息。

【解决方案2】:

看起来像 JDK 错误JDK-6675699。根据错误报告,该错误的修复已被向后移植到 8u74、8u81 和 8u82。

请注意,(截至目前)以最终用户为中心的 Java Download Site 提供 8u73 作为最新版本。你可以从Java Developer Download Site获取8u74。


如果更新到 8u74 不能解决问题,那么您应该将此作为错误报告提交给 Oracle。可能的诊断是您正在运行的代码导致 JIT 代码编译器在尝试编译/优化它时崩溃。这就是PhaseIdealLoop::idom_no_update 所表明的。

JDK-6675699 是针对特定 JIT 编译器错误的。很可能还有其他未诊断的 JIT 编译器错误。如果您提交新的错误报告,它可以帮助维护人员追踪这些错误。但是,只有在您能够提供足够的信息让他们重现您的错误时,错误报告才会对他们有用。

(当然,根本原因也可能是完全不同的;例如,您的代码中的某些第 3 方代码破坏了导致编译器崩溃的 JVM 数据结构。但对于损坏以重复破坏编译器......并且只有编译器。)


更新 - 根据这些Release Notes,您实际需要的版本是Java SE 8u74-b32。

【解决方案3】:

我认为你应该花一些时间来分析核心。

分段错误

这有几个可能的原因。 JVM 本身或包中可能存在错误(其中一些是用 C 或 C++ 编写的)。这也可能是由于不兼容的组件一起使用的错误配置造成的。

根据经验,JVM 错误是其中最不可能的。尽管@Stephen 认为这很可能是这种情况。

如果您在崩溃点捕获堆栈跟踪,这可能会为您提供一些关于崩溃发生的确切位置的线索。

首先,我看到您需要配置 ulimit -c unlimited 以便您可以将核心文件存储到磁盘。

分析核心文件
完成后,您应该使用以下方法分析核心。

要转换文件,请使用命令行工具 jmap。

jmap -dump:format=b,file=dump.hprof /usr/bin/java core_file

地点:

dump.hprof 是您要创建的 hprof 文件的名称

/usr/bin/java 是生成核心转储的 java 二进制文件版本的路径
